现代电子技术
現代電子技術
현대전자기술
MODERN ELECTRONICS TECHNIQUE
2014年
14期
138-141
,共4页
SPI接口%串行总线接口%LabVIEW%测试
SPI接口%串行總線接口%LabVIEW%測試
SPI접구%천행총선접구%LabVIEW%측시
SPI interface%serial bus interface%LabVIEW%testing
为了便于具有SPI串行总线接口设备的调试,使用美国国家仪器公司(NI)的标准模块化设备模拟SPI串行总线接口信号;采用图形化编程语言LabVIEW得到数字波形格式的SPI信号,并设计程序对此格式的信号进行解析,利用NI公司的硬件设备实现该信号的输入与输出。经过实验测试,输出SPI接口信号的频率范围是0.5 Hz~500 kHz,输入的频率范围是0.5 Hz~900 kHz,误差小于10 ns,该方法可以用于SPI串行总线接口设备的调试中。
為瞭便于具有SPI串行總線接口設備的調試,使用美國國傢儀器公司(NI)的標準模塊化設備模擬SPI串行總線接口信號;採用圖形化編程語言LabVIEW得到數字波形格式的SPI信號,併設計程序對此格式的信號進行解析,利用NI公司的硬件設備實現該信號的輸入與輸齣。經過實驗測試,輸齣SPI接口信號的頻率範圍是0.5 Hz~500 kHz,輸入的頻率範圍是0.5 Hz~900 kHz,誤差小于10 ns,該方法可以用于SPI串行總線接口設備的調試中。
위료편우구유SPI천행총선접구설비적조시,사용미국국가의기공사(NI)적표준모괴화설비모의SPI천행총선접구신호;채용도형화편정어언LabVIEW득도수자파형격식적SPI신호,병설계정서대차격식적신호진행해석,이용NI공사적경건설비실현해신호적수입여수출。경과실험측시,수출SPI접구신호적빈솔범위시0.5 Hz~500 kHz,수입적빈솔범위시0.5 Hz~900 kHz,오차소우10 ns,해방법가이용우SPI천행총선접구설비적조시중。
In order to debug the device with SPI serial bus interface conveniently,the standard modular device of National Instruments(NI)was used to simulate SPI serial bus interface signals,LabVIEW was used to get the SPI signals in digital wave-form format,a program was designed to analysis these signals,and the hardware equipments of NI was utilized to realize the in-put and output of these signals. The experimental testing result shows that the frequency range of the output signal from the SPI interface is 0.5 Hz to 500 kHz,the input frequency range is 0.5 Hz to 900 kHz,the error is less than 10 ns. This method can be used to debug SPI serial bus interface device.